A fast direct solver for high frequency scattering from a large cavity in two dimensions

Jun Lai, Sivaram Ambikasaran, Leslie F. Greengard

Published 2014-04-14Version 1

We present a fast direct solver for the simulation of electromagnetic scattering from an arbitrarily-shaped, large, empty cavity embedded in an infinite perfectly conducting half space. The governing Maxwell equations are reformulated as a well-conditioned second kind integral equation and the resulting linear system is solved in nearly linear time using a hierarchical matrix factorization technique. We illustrate the performance of the scheme with several numerical examples for complex cavity shapes over a wide range of frequencies.
